## GraphTrace Environments

GraphTrace, our dependency graph visualizer, runs in three environments: dev, staging, and prod. Support staff should only query staging when reproducing customer issues, since prod rendering jobs are rate-limited. Each environment pulls its settings from the Vexley config store at boot. The staging environment uses the following configuration values.

deployment values, yadug-bawif:
[framir]
team = pelox
access_code = ac_a38ab2
owner = tamion.julael
host = framir.tolvaqlabs.test
port = 11211
peer = tammir.zemvargrid.local
salt = 2215ef03
pin = 1541

## Session Handling for Health Checks

The Corvel gateway sits behind the Lanternside load balancer, which probes /healthz every ten seconds. Health-check requests are stateless by design: they bypass the session store entirely so that probe traffic never inflates session counts or evicts real user sessions. New team members should note that the deep-check endpoint, /healthz/deep, does verify session-store connectivity and therefore requires authentication. When probing it manually, supply the token below.

bearer token for tajep-kajef: eyJhbGciOiJIUzI1NiIsInR5cCI6IkpXVCJ9.eyJzdWIiOiIoOsZ23In0.CsygO0hs

Blue-Green Deploys: Billfork Worker

Symptom: invoices stall after a cutover. Cause: the green pool starts before the queue drain on blue completes. Fix: check the drain status endpoint first. If blue still holds messages, pause the cutover and requeue. Never flip traffic while drain shows pending. Rollback: point the router alias back at blue, restart the consumer, confirm invoice throughput recovers within two minutes. To query the drain status endpoint on staging, authenticate with the bearer token below.

session JWT of yawep-yawep = eyJhbGciOiJIUzI1NiIsInR5cCI6IkpXVCJ9.eyJzdWIiOiI3pWF3_In0.aXYsHiog